Output b5b51db42b723d61fa8cde9983b5f007e8ac831af7237c5ef44cb4bd84ed1ec6:0

value
28861509
script pubkey
OP_0 OP_PUSHBYTES_20 c3926bdf251a8a33c073923c80b6e10775ca77da
address
bc1qcwfxhhe9r29r8srnjg7gpdhpqa6u5a76aac5dj
transaction
b5b51db42b723d61fa8cde9983b5f007e8ac831af7237c5ef44cb4bd84ed1ec6
confirmations
250848
spent
true